No More Point Spreads

Many people think that it is easier to bet on baseball than any other sport. One of the reasons that people think this way is because there are no MLB point spreads.

When you place a bet on a sporting event, there are many things that you have to consider to increase your chances of winning you wager. One of these factors is the point spread. There are many sports that use point spreads, like football and basketball, but with baseball, there are no MLB point spreads.

If odds makers used MLB point spreads, the smallest amount that a line could move would be ½ a run. A ½ point would not make a huge difference in sports like football and basketball where there a lot of points scored, but ½ run in baseball could make a huge difference in winning or losing your bet. This is why MLB point spreads are not used; instead Major League Baseball uses money lines.

Now you are probably wondering what a money line is. The money line in baseball is very similar to a point spread in football or basketball. The money line is used to equal out the attractiveness of the favorite and the underdog when placing a bet. When you bet with a money line, the outcome of the bet is decided by the games straight up winner, this means that you do not have to worry about your team covering the point spread.
